            <title>Intercontinental Hotel San Francisco: IHG June 2008</title>
            <link>http://meetingscollaborative.com/index.php?option=com_content&amp;task=view&amp;id=1090&amp;Itemid=#jreview_101</link>
            <description><![CDATA[<p>This new addition to the IHG is beautiful and very conveniently located right next door to Moscone West.  <br />
I booked sleeping rooms and meeting space in conjunction with a tradeshow.  <br />
The sleeping rooms are beautiful, comfortable and quiet - my room had an amazing view of the Bay and the lights across the Bay.<br />
The meeting space is also beautiful with the latest technology available.  All spaces have built in Buffet areas perfect for drink and small food set-up.  Even the smaller rooms are large enough to allow meals to be wheeled in an allow for space for a conference set-up for 10 and a cocktail round with 2 to 4 chairs.<br />
All of the staff were professional, very helpful and made every attempt to anticipate our needs.<br />
The sleeing room rates, meeting space rental and F&B were competitive and the staff was able to work with me to develop a plan to meet our budget.<br />
I would definitely recommend using this hotel.</p>]]></description>

            <title>Kabuki Hotel: Stylish, Convenient, Reasonably Priced</title>
            <link>http://meetingscollaborative.com/index.php?option=com_content&amp;task=view&amp;id=1364&amp;Itemid=#jreview_39</link>
            <description><![CDATA[<p>Renovated in 2007 so everything is sparkling new. Meeting space is very convenient. Location in Japantown is unusual and our delegates liked this about the hotel. There is an arcade attached to the hotel with many shops and restaurants and great eating places closeby. The trolley car stops out front to Union Square so even though its away from the Wharf area, it doesn't take long to get there by public transport. Conference staff are easy going and professional - we took our training course there 2 years in a row.</p>]]></description>
